JOB DESCRIPTION
This role will support the Organizational development team by managing the LMS (Cornerstone) and training management including scheduling, managing communication calendar, gathering data and reporting, managing course resources. They will support talent management programs and projects. Attention to detail and managing multiple projects and deadlines is critical.
JOB SUMMARY
Organizes all logistics of instructor-led courses, including scheduling, selection of training facilities, production of training materials, scheduling facilities, and provision of multimedia tools.
Administers the company's learning management and professional development systems. Retools these systems as needed to accommodate changing needs and new instructional technologies.
Support talent management programs and processes including managing data, drafting reports, and tracking progress.

ADDITIONAL JOB DUTIES
Administers the company's HR learning management and professional development systems.
Manages the registration process and systems for all HR training and development programs.
Organizes all logistics of HR instructor-led courses, including scheduling, selection of training facilities, production of training materials, scheduling facilities, arranging catering and provision of multimedia tools.
Integrates developed HR coursework with content delivery platforms, including learning management systems, talent management systems and websites.
Guides users through account set-up and functionality of the learning management and professional development systems.
Provides reports to management, collecting data from multiple systems, as necessary.
Prefer experience with multimedia authoring tools, including, but not limited to PowerPoint and Articulate.
Track and report on HR training outcomes.
Uses appropriate tools to capture and manage talent management program and process data.
Track and report on talent management program progress.
Create reports on talent management program outcomes.
EXPERIENCE
Experience with Articulate : Demonstrated proficiency in using Articulate software to develop, manage, and deliver engaging learning content or presentations.
Requires minimum 2 years job related work experience in excess of degree requirements
Requires minimum of 2 years progressively responsible experience in administering training programs and web-based training systems
Requires minimum of 1 year experience with Learning Management Systems and Talent Management Systems
SKILLS
LMS experience (Cornerstone preferred)
Articulate-a must
Program / Project Management
Scheduling
Microsoft Office
Adobe Acrobat Pro
EDUCATION
Bachelor's Degree : Education, Communications, Training and Development, Instructional / Curriculum Design, Instructional Technology, Business Administration or related field (Required)
or a combination of education and experience that provides equivalent knowledge to a major in such fields is required
